Thank you so much that did the trick!Roll the screen around the pipe where the holes are but extend the screen down well past the bottom of the pipe into the water. The water will flow off with no splashing.
Cut a 6" piece of 1/4" tubing and stick it into the hole on top of the drain until it is about 2" into the water. This should break the siphon and quiet down the overflow.
